BBC - Rights Gone Wrong (2012)

BBC - Rights Gone Wrong (2012)



Information
Anger over votes for prisoners and the release of Abu Qatada shows just what a toxic issue human rights law has become. In this provocative film, Andrew Neil travels to Europe and across Britain to find out why Britain follows these laws and asks can anything be done to restore our faith in them?
